Austria, 1822/1964, postal history collection, broad assembly of over 150 covers spanning the pre-stamp period through the mid-twentieth century, with notable strength in the 1880s–1890s and 1920s, including early stampless folded letters, Franz Josef issues, and a substantial range of postal stationery cards and covers showing varied frankings and cancellations through the end of the First World War, with technical highlights including a specialised group from the early 1920s inflation period bearing complex multiple frankings, eight covers from the Anschluss period (1938–1945), and several post-Second World War censored items with multiple frankings of the popular Costume definitives, further enhanced by a strong showing of postmark types, commercial corner-card mail, wrappers, and registered usages, generally fine-very fine throughout.
